That is some crazy timing. It just so happens I ripped the rear wheel off mine last night to measure it. Mine are a different style rim to yours, but I assume the specs would be the same as mine is a SV420 also.
While I'm sure its not 100% exact, I got 194mm from outer lip to outer lip on the rim. I also measured ~ 115mm from the back lip to the mounting face of the rim. Considering zero offset would be 97mm (half of 194mm), that gives the standard rims approx +18 offset to my calculations.
Depending on the size of the tyre you want to run, I reckon a 0 offset rim would be pretty much spot on.
